Software Development Kit Implementasi Augmented Reality Pada Alat Musik Bonang Jawa Berbasis Android

1. Face Tracking Face Tracking adalah teknologi Augmented Reality dengan menggunakan algoritma yang dapat mendeteksi wajah manusia secara umum dengan cara mengenali posisi mata, hidung dan mulut. 2. 3D Object Tracking 3D Object Tracking dapat mengenali bentuk yang lebih banyak, seperti lemari, meja, televisi, dan lain-lain. 3. Motion Tracking Motion Tracking merupakan teknik Augmented Reality yang dapat menangkap gerakan. Umumnya digunakan dalam industri perfilman seperti karakter dan tokoh yang sesuai dengan peran dan kebutuhan film tersebut. 4. Global Positioning System Based Tracking Global Positioning System GPS Based Tracking adalah teknik Augmented Reality yang diintegrasikan dengan GPS yang terdapat pada ponsel pintar yang menampilkan informasi data dari GPS kemudian menampilkannya dalam bentuk arah sesuai dengan yang kita inginkan secara real-time.

2.3 Software Development Kit

Software Development Kit SDK atau devkit tipikal merupakan satu set perkakas pengembangan software yang digunakan untuk mengembangkan atau membuat aplikasi untuk paket software tertentu, software framework, hardware platform, sistem komputer, konsol video game, sistem operasi atau platform sejenis lainnya. Ia mencakup mulai dari pemrograman sederhana seperti sebuah Application Programming Interface API, sampai dengan pemrograman yang lebih rumit dengan hardware yang canggih atau pada sistem embedded termasuk perangkat mobile. Adapun yang merupakan Software Development Kit untuk Augmented Reality dalam penerapan alat musik Bonang Jawa, adalah sebagai berikut: 1. Vuforia Dalam pembangunan sebuah sistem dengan menggunakan Unity maka dibutuhkan Vuforia. Vuforia merupakan ekstensi Augmented Reality ynag diciptakan oleh Qualcomn dan Vuforia sangat tergantung pada software Unity 3D. Vuforia adalah marker dasar sistem Augmented Reality dan Vuforia dapat mendeteksi gambar dan mengikuti kemampuan sistem ke dalam IDE Integrated Development Environment Unity 3D, Vuforia juga mengizinkan pembangunan sistem untuk untuk menciptakan secara mudah aplikasi Augmented Reality dan permainan games. Santoso 2012 menyebutkan sebuah Vuforia berdasarkan aplikasi Augmented Reality disusun mengikuti komponen utama, yaitu kamera, pengubah gambar, tracker, video background renderer, kode aplikasi dan sumber-sumber target. Mulai RegisterLogin Developer Vuforia Target Manager Buat Database Baru Unggah Gambar Memilih Marker Mengunduh Target Dataset Menghubungkan dengan Aplikasi Selesai Database Ya Tidak Gambar 2.4 Diagram Alur Pembuatan Marker pada Vuforia Diagram alur pembuatan marker pada vuforia ditunjukkan seperti pada Gambar 2.4 menunjukkan tahapan membuat marker pada vuforia yang dimulai dari registrasi atau login pada voforia kemudian dengan membuat database dan beberapa proses selanjutnya hingga selesai menjadi sebuah marker. 2. Unity 3D Unity technologies dibangun pada tahun 2004 oleh David Helgason, Nicholas Francis, dan Joachim Ante. Unity adalah sebuah game engine yang dapat digunakan perseorangan maupun tim. Unity merupakan sebuah komputasi metode yang diterapkan dan dioperasikan antar beberapa platform komputer yang dikembangkan oleh Unity Technology. Roedavan 2014 menyatakan bahwa perangkat lunak yang dirancang untuk membuat sebuah game disebut Game Engine. Maka dari itu Unity 3D digunakan sebagai perancang objek 3D sekaligus aplikasi Augmented Reality berbasis Android karena libraries Vuforia didukung oleh Unity 3D. Alur kerja pengembangan sistem berbasis marker